首页 > 其他分享 >【笔记】吉如一线段树

【笔记】吉如一线段树

时间:2024-08-13 15:26:59浏览次数:17  
标签:min 段树 笔记 区间 吉如 mx se

【笔记】吉如一线段树

吉如一论文(CQBZ内网,在 PDF 的 103 页


1 区间最值操作

1.1 区间取 min(max),区间和

当前应该修改值为 \(x\);

维护区间最大值 \(mx\),最大值个数 \(t\),严格次大值 \(se\)。

如果走到一个区间上,如果:

  1. \(x\ge mx\),说明取min操作没用,直接 return;
  2. \(mx>x>se\),打标记,把 \(mx\) 改成 \(x\),再用 \((mx-x)\times t\) 更新区间和;
  3. 如果 \(x\le se\),暴力走两边递归下去。

1.2 区间取 min/max,区间加,查询区间和

2 历史最值查询

3 历史和查询

标签:min,段树,笔记,区间,吉如,mx,se
From: https://www.cnblogs.com/CloudWings/p/18357027

相关文章

  • VisionPro二次开发学习笔记13-使用CogToolBlock进行图像交互
    该程序演示了如何使用CogToolBlock进行图像交互.从vpp文件中加载一个ToolBlock。用户可以通过应用程序窗体上的数字增减控件修改ToolBlock输入端子的值。用户还可以从coins.idb或采集FIFO中选择图像。“运行一次”按钮执行以下操作:获取下一个图像或读取下一个图像......
  • 算法的学习笔记——二进制中 1 的个数(牛客JZ15)
    ......
  • CSS笔记总结(Xmind格式):第二天
    Xmind鸟瞰图:简单文字总结:css知识总结:复合选择器:  1.交集选择器:在一个选择器的基础上,再增加一个选择器来增加条件(中间不能有任何符号包括空格)  2.并集选择器:多个选择器之间用逗号隔开,表示同时选择多个标签使用样式  3.后代选择器:使用空格分隔  4.子元......
  • JavaScript高阶笔记总结(Xmind格式):第三天
    Xmind鸟瞰图:简单文字总结:js高阶笔记总结:严格模式:  1.开启严格模式:"usestrict"  2.不使用var关键字声明会报错  3.严格模式下普通函数的this指向undefined高阶函数:  满足其中之一即高阶函数:    1.函数作为参数    2.函数作为返回值......
  • 论文阅读笔记:Mixed Pseudo Labels for Semi-Supervised Object Detection
    论文阅读笔记:MixedPseudoLabelsforSemi-SupervisedObjectDetection1背景1.1动机1.2问题2创新点3方法4模块4.1预处理策略4.2PseudoMixup4.3PseudoMosaic4.4标签重采样4.5分析5实验5.1和SOTA方法对比5.2消融实验论文:https://arxiv.org/pdf/231......
  • 网络流学习笔记
    前言zr游记系列因作者在考试的重重打击下,它,寄了。作者还是写下了这一片“网络流学习笔记”来纪念学会了网络流。废话不多说了,笔记要不是抄别人博客的,要么是抄老师课件的。基本概念关于网络流的网络流\((NetWorkFlow)\):一种类比水流的解决问题的方法。(下述概念均会用水......
  • 【笔记】传统势能线段树
    1引入传统线段树能够通过打标记实现区间修改的条件有两个:能够快速处理标记对区间询问结果的影响;能够快速实现标记的合并。有的区间修改不满足上面两个条件。但存在一些奇妙的性质,使得序列每个元素被修改的次数有一个上限。如果我们保证每暴力\(O(\logn)\)修改一次的时......
  • HCIP笔记8-BGP(2)
    一、BGP的宣告问题1.在BGP协议中每台运行BGP的设备上,宣告本地直连路由2.*在BGP协议中运行BGP协议的设备还可以宣告通过IGP学习到的,未运行BGP协议设备产生的路由;在BGP协议中宣告本地路由表中路由条目时,将携带本地到达这些目标的IGP度量值;传递到BGP邻居处;其他AS设备便于选择离......
  • 极限学习笔记
    这个人太菜了,轻喷。数列极限定义数列的概念自变量为正整数的函数\(u_n=f(n)\),其中\(n=1,2,3\cdots\),将其函数值按自变量从小到大排成一列数\(u_1,u_2\cdotsu_n\cdots\),称为数列,将其简记为\(\{u_n\}\)。其中\(u_n\)称为数列的通项或者一般项。、数列极限的定义(\(\eps......